Episode description

Tembi Locke is a New York Times best-selling author, screenwriter, producer, actor and podcast host. Her book ‘From Scratch: A Memoir of Love, Sicily, and Finding Home’ follows her real-life love story, that all began with a chance encounter in the streets of Florence, where she fell in love with an Italian chef. Her life-changing journey of love, loss, resilience and hope was adapted for the screen by Netflix, in the limited series starring Zoe Saldana. Locke sat down with Hoda Kotb for a beautiful conversation on love, life after loss and how to begin again.
